Berdasarkan Nouveau, driver baru untuk API grafis Vulkan sedang dikembangkan

Pengembang dari Red Hat dan Collabora telah mulai membuat driver Vulkan nvk terbuka untuk kartu grafis NVIDIA, yang akan melengkapi driver anv (Intel), radv (AMD), tu (Qualcomm) dan v3dv (Broadcom VideoCore VI) yang sudah tersedia di Mesa. Driver sedang dikembangkan berdasarkan proyek Nouveau menggunakan beberapa subsistem yang sebelumnya digunakan pada driver Nouveau OpenGL.

Secara paralel, Nouveau mulai bekerja untuk memindahkan fungsionalitas universal ke perpustakaan terpisah yang dapat digunakan di driver lain. Misalnya, komponen untuk pembuatan kode yang dapat digunakan untuk berbagi kompiler shader di driver untuk OpenGL dan Vulkan telah dipindahkan ke perpustakaan .

Pengembangan driver Vulkan termasuk Karol Herbst, pengembang Nouveau di Red Hat, David Airlie, pengelola DRM di Red Hat, dan Jason Ekstrand, pengembang Mesa yang aktif di Collabora. Driver berada pada tahap awal pengembangan dan belum cocok untuk aplikasi selain menjalankan utilitas vulkaninfo. Kebutuhan akan driver baru disebabkan oleh kurangnya driver Vulkan terbuka untuk kartu video NVIDIA, sementara semakin banyak game yang menggunakan API grafis ini atau dijalankan di Linux menggunakan lapisan yang menerjemahkan panggilan Direct3D ke API Vulkan.

Sumber: opennet.ru

Tambah komentar